Hercules POT-Type Bearings – High Load Capacity & Multi-Directional Movement
The Hercules POT Bearings (HPT) are advanced structural support solutions for large-scale infrastructure projects. Because they can handle high vertical and horizontal loads while accommodating various movements, engineers widely use these bearings in modern bridge construction, high-rise buildings, and offshore platforms.
Specifically, a POT bearing features a steel pot that houses an elastomeric pad and a piston, which enables slight deformation under load. In turn, this design absorbs forces, minimizes stress, and maintains structural stability. To elaborate, the elastomer provides damping and flexibility, while the steel pot ensures durability under extreme load conditions.
Types of Hercules POT Bearings
-
First, Fixed POT Bearings (FX) restrict all movement and are therefore suitable for locations without horizontal or vertical displacement.
-
Vertical Load Capacity: 300 kN to 30,000 kN.
-
-
In contrast, Sliding Guided POT Bearings (SG) allow horizontal movement, making them ideal for thermal expansion or seismic activity.
-
Movement Capacity: ±50 mm longitudinal, ±20 mm transverse.
-
-
Furthermore, Free Float POT Bearings (FF) support multi-directional movement for the most dynamic load conditions.
-
Designers commonly use them in seismic-resistant designs.
-
-
Finally, we engineer Custom Designed POT Bearings (Series C) for non-standard load combinations, skew movements, and other unique seismic requirements.

Design Features & Specifications
-
Vertical Load Capacity: 300–30,000 kN (tested at 150% rated load).
-
Rotation Capacity: 0.030 rads (small) to 0.015 rads (large), with special designs up to 0.200 rads.
-
Materials:
-
For example, the Elastomeric Pad has high tensile strength, tear resistance, and compression set performance.
-
We also bond the PTFE Sliding Pads for low friction and minimal wear.
